Opis awersu Allegory of Australia as a woman standing, facing right, wearing drape, holding laurel wreath in raised right hand and supporting shield with the coat of arms of New South Wales. Implements of arts, industry, and commerce at her feet: a violin, square, hammer, and anvil to the left and an anchor, books, amphora, ship helm, anemometer, and painting palette to the right. Five water waves below. Brick wall behind. Elevation of the Garden Palace by James Barnet in the background.
Pismo awersu Latin
Legenda awersu ★ INTERNATIONAL ★ EXHIBITION ★ ORTA RECENS QUAM PURA NITES SYDNEY N . S . W . ★ M . D . CCC . LXXIX J . S . & A . B . WYON
(Translation: Newly risen, how brightly you shine.)
Opis rewersu Inscription in two lines, surrounded by foliage and flowers arranged in a wreath.
Pismo rewersu Latin
Legenda rewersu H . SOANE . ⸻ · ⸻ SECOND AWARD J . S . & A . B . WYON
